Knitted socks for baby and children in DROPS Merino Extra Fine or DROPS Fiesta. Piece is knitted in rib. Size 1 month - 4 years

---------------------------------------------------------- EXPLANATION FOR THE PATTERN: ---------------------------------------------------------- HEEL DECREASE: ROW 1 (= right side): Work until 5-6-6 (6-7) stitches remain, slip next stitch knitwise, knit 1, pass slipped stitch over, turn piece. ROW 2 (= wrong side): Work until 5-6-6 (6-7) stitches remain, slip next stitch purlwise, purl 1, pass slipped stitch over, turn piece. ROW 3 (= right side): Work until 4-5-5 (5-6) stitches remain, slip next stitch, knit 1, pass slipped stitch over, turn piece. ROW 4 (= wrong side): Work until 4-5-5 (5-6) stitches remain, slip next stitch, purl 1, pass slipped stitch over, turn piece. Continue decrease like this with 1 stitch less before each decrease until there are 8-10-10 (10-12) stitches on needle. DECREASE TIP-1: Decrease as follows before rib stitches: Knit 2 together. Decrease as follows after rib stitches: Slip 1 stitch knitwise, knit 1, pass slipped stitch over. DECREASE TIP-2: Decrease as follows before marker: Knit 2 together. Decrease as follows after marker: Slip 1 stitch knitwise, knit 1, pass slipped stitch over. ---------------------------------------------------------- START THE PIECE HERE: ---------------------------------------------------------- SOCK - SHORT SUMMARY OF PIECE: Worked in the round on double pointed needles from leg down to toe. LEG: Cast on 32-36-40 (44-48) stitches on double pointed needles size 3 mm with DROPS Merino Extra Fine or DROPS Fiesta. Work rib = knit 2/purl 2 for 7-8-9 (10-11) cm. REMEMBER THE KNITTING TENSION! Now work heel and foot as explained below. HEEL AND FOOT: Work stocking stitch over the first 9-9-9 (9-13) stitches and keep stitches on needle for heel, slip the next 16-16-20 (24-24) stitches on a thread (mid on top of foot), and keep the last 7-11-11 (11-11) stitches on needle for heel = 16-20-20 (20-24) heel stitches on needle. Work in stocking stitch back and forth over heel stitches for 3½-4-4½ (5-5) cm. Insert 1 marker in the middle of last row - measure piece from this marker later. Work HEEL DECREASE - read explanation above! After heel decrease work next round as follows: Work in stocking stitch over the 8-10-10 (10-12) heel stitches, pick up 8-9-10 (12-12) stitches along the side of heel, work rib over the 16-16-20 (24-24) stitches from thread on top of foot, and pick up 8-9-10 (12-12) stitches along the other side of heel = 40-44-50 (58-60) stitches. Work until mid under heel – round now begins here. Continue with rib over 16-16-20 (24-24) stitches on upper foot and in stocking stitch over the remaining stitches. Insert 1 marker on each side of the middle 14-14-18-22-22) rib stitches. On first round decrease 1 stitch before first marker and 1 stitch after last marker – read DECREASE TIP-1. Decrease like this every other round 3-4-5 (8-8) times in total = 34-36-40 (42-44) stitches. Work until piece measures 8-9-10 (11-13) cm from marker on heel – measured under foot. 3-3-3 (4-4) cm remain until finished measurements. TOE: Insert 1 marker in each side of sock so that there are 17-18-20 (21-22 ) stitches both on top of foot and under foot. Work in stocking stitch. AT THE SAME TIME on first round decrease for toes on each side of both markers – read DECREASE TIP-2. Decrease like this on every other round 3-3-2 (4-4) times in total and then on every round 4-4-6 (5-5) times in total = 6-8-8 (6-8) stitches. Cut the yarn and pull yarn through stitches, tighten together and fasten. The sock measures approx. 11-12-13 (15-17) cm from marker on heel – measured under foot. Work the other sock the same way. |
